#c280dc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c280dc is composed of 76.1% red, 50.2%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.8% cyan, 41.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 283 degrees, a saturation of 56.8% and a lightness of 68.2%. #c280dc color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#8501b9.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#c280dc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#09030b is the darkest color, while #fdfb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#c280dc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#afacb0 is the less saturated color, while #d061fb is the most saturated one.
